Commit 2504df5b authored by Seblu's avatar Seblu
Browse files

make tar always recreate tarball

parent 1ee8c28b
Loading
Loading
Loading
Loading
+6 −5
Original line number Diff line number Diff line
@@ -12,14 +12,14 @@ all:
$(NAME)-$(VERSION).tar.gz:
	git archive --prefix=$(NAME)-$(VERSION)/ HEAD | gzip -9 > $(NAME)-$(VERSION).tar.gz

tar: $(NAME)-$(VERSION).tar.gz
tar: cleantar $(NAME)-$(VERSION).tar.gz

dsc: cleanbuild tar
dsc: cleanbuild $(NAME)-$(VERSION).tar.gz
	mkdir $(BUILD_DIR)
	tar xfC $(NAME)-$(VERSION).tar.gz $(BUILD_DIR)
	cd $(BUILD_DIR) && dpkg-source -I -b $(NAME)-$(VERSION)

deb: cleanbuild
deb: cleanbuild $(NAME)-$(VERSION).tar.gz
	mkdir $(BUILD_DIR)
	tar xfC $(NAME)-$(VERSION).tar.gz $(BUILD_DIR)
	cd $(BUILD_DIR)/$(NAME)-$(VERSION) && dpkg-buildpackage --source-option=-I
@@ -28,9 +28,10 @@ buildd: dsc
	chmod 644 $(BUILD_DIR)/$(NAME)_*.dsc $(BUILD_DIR)/$(NAME)_*.gz
	scp $(BUILD_DIR)/$(NAME)_*.dsc $(BUILD_DIR)/$(NAME)_*.gz incoming@buildd.fr.lan:sid

clean: cleanbuild
	-rm -f $(NAME)-$(VERSION).tar.gz
clean: cleantar cleanbuild

cleanbuild:
	-rm -rf  $(BUILD_DIR)

cleantar:
	-rm -f $(NAME)-$(VERSION).tar.gz